htdb_stat.cc File Reference

#include <sys/types.h>
#include <time.h>
#include <ctype.h>
#include <errno.h>
#include <stdlib.h>
#include <string.h>
#include <unistd.h>
#include "db_int.h"
#include "db_page.h"
#include "db_shash.h"
#include "lock.h"
#include "mp.h"
#include "util_sig.h"
#include "WordDBInfo.h"
#include "WordDBCompress.h"
#include "WordContext.h"

Go to the source code of this file.

Defines

#define PCT(f, t, pgsize)

Enumerations

enum  test_t {
  T_NOTSET, T_DB, T_ENV, T_LOCK,
  T_LOG, T_MPOOL, T_TXN
}

Functions

void usage __P ((void))
int txn_compare __P ((const void *, const void *))
void prflags __P ((u_int32_t, const FN *))
int main __P ((int, char *[]))
int lock_ok __P ((char *))
int env_stats __P ((DB_ENV *))
void dl_bytes __P ((const char *, u_long, u_long, u_long))
void dl __P ((const char *, u_long))
int db_init __P ((char *, test_t))
int btree_stats __P ((DB_ENV *, DB *))
int argcheck __P ((char *, const char *))
int argcheck (char *arg, const char *ok_args)
int btree_stats (DB_ENV *dbenvp, DB *dbp)
int db_init (char *home, test_t ttype)
void dl (const char *msg, u_long value)
void dl_bytes (const char *msg, u_long gbytes, u_long mbytes, u_long bytes)
int env_stats (DB_ENV *dbenvp)
int hash_stats (DB_ENV *dbenvp, DB *dbp)
int lock_stats (DB_ENV *dbenvp)
int log_stats (DB_ENV *dbenvp)
int main (int argc, char *argv[])
int mpool_stats (DB_ENV *dbenvp)
void prflags (u_int32_t flags, const FN *fnp)
int queue_stats (DB_ENV *dbenvp, DB *dbp)
int txn_compare (const void *a1, const void *b1)
int txn_stats (DB_ENV *dbenvp)
void usage ()

Variables

static const char copyright []
DB_ENVdbenv
char * internal
const char * progname = "htdb_stat"
static const char revid []


Generated on Sun Jun 8 10:56:57 2008 for GNUmifluz by  doxygen 1.5.5